This year, I have an overwhelming number of students facing challenges in the areas of physical and occupational therapy. I am hopeful that the stools and swivel chairs can give my second grade scholars some options when doing their reading groups, seat work and computer activities. The "one-size-fits-all" plastic chairs are just not meeting the children's needs. I have students in my classroom that are the size of an average 5th grader and other students who could pass for preschoolers...truly, it is unbelievable. I am most hopeful that these chairs will make a difference in their learning. The stools will be used to help bolster core strength during small group activities. The swivel chairs will help my smaller students see the computer at THEIR level, while also helping my larger students feel more comfortable at the computer station.
